Parents of Color Caucus (POCC)
The Parents of Color Caucus at TOPS K-8
Mission Statement
The Parents of Color Caucus is an organized body of parents and caregivers of color at TOPS K-8 School. The caucus serves to strengthen the voices and participation of students and families of color within the school. The caucus exercises influence in developing school policies, practices and procedures affecting students of color through representation on the Executive Site Council, the Building Leadership Team, and by working in tandem with the Racial Equity Team. The caucus helps to inform the TOPS mission of social justice by building the capacity of parents, caregivers and students of color to improve school policies and procedures for students and families of color at TOPS.
Vision
The vision for the Parents of Color Caucus is to center voices of color, creating a sense of belonging, success, ownership and preparedness for high school for students of color at TOPS. The caucus aims to create a space for productive dialogue concerning the school’s mission of social justice and provide missing feedback from families of color at TOPS.
